Risking growing wild vegetables, a farmer in Hau Giang unexpectedly grew and sold them, becoming rich.

In recent years, many farmers in Vi Thanh city, Hau Giang province have converted inefficient, low-yield rice fields to growing other crops on rice fields, including wild vegetables, field vegetables, specifically the plant Cu Neo. This has brought significant results for farmers.

The model of growing cu neo trees to sell as specialty vegetables, delicious wild vegetables, and clean vegetables of Mr. Lam Van Son's family, a farmer in Ward 7, Vi Thanh City, Hau Giang Province, is bringing high economic efficiency.

A typical example of the conversion of crop and livestock structure to bring high economic efficiency is the household of Mr. Lam Van Son, residing in area 2, ward 7, Vi Thanh city, Hau Giang province.

His family has 6,000 square meters of land for growing fruit trees that are ineffective and have low productivity due to acid sulfate soil. Growing fruit trees is not economically efficient, so he decided to switch to growing more suitable vegetables.

After a period of research, learning, and selecting vegetable varieties suitable for his land, he realized that rau cu neo - a specialty vegetable that grows wild in ditches - grows and develops very well on alum-contaminated soil.

The water fern is a delicious, clean vegetable that does not cost much to buy seeds, is inexpensive, easy to care for, and is very popular in the market, so we decided to grow water fern to take advantage of the existing water surface area of ​​2,000m2.

Mr. Lam Van Son shared: The water fern plant is very easy to grow, and the seeds do not cost money to buy. He mainly collects wild water fern plants to grow.

After two months of taking care of his family, Mr. Son started harvesting the young shoots of the water spinach. Every day he picked 20 kg of young shoots of the water spinach.

The selling price of this type of wild vegetable is 15,000 VND/kg. He brings the wild vegetable to the markets, and earns 200,000 VND every day.

With 2,000m2 of growing rau cu neo - a specialty vegetable, Mr. Lam Van Son's family has an income of 60 million VND/year, after deducting expenses, the profit is 50 million VND.

Mr. Lam Van Son, a typical example of crop restructuring in Ward 7, Vi Thanh City, Hau Giang Province, added: Watercress is a very easy-to-grow plant, low cost, low care and low risk compared to some other crops.

In particular, growing this type of wild vegetable and field vegetable has a year-round income source. He will continue to maintain and expand this model to increase income and stabilize his family's life.
